茯苓为多孔菌科真菌茯苓的干燥菌核,性味甘、淡、平,归心、脾、肾经,功能利水渗湿、健脾安神,主要成分菌核含β-茯苓聚糖、茯苓酸、麦角固醇、胆碱、组氨酸、卵磷脂及钾盐等,药理研究证实有利尿、镇静、抗菌、抗肿瘤、增强免疫〔1〕
